Stay Hydrated on Keto: Optimize Your Health

Achieving optimal results on a ketogenic diet hinges heavily on staying adequately well-watered. When you restrict carbohydrates, your body enters ketosis, a metabolic state where it primarily burns fat for fuel. This process produces ketone bodies, which can sometimes lead to increased urine output and potential dehydration if not offset properly.

To ensure proper hydration on keto, strive to drink plenty of fluids. Aim for at least eight glasses per day, and explore incorporating other hydrating options like herbal teas or electrolyte-rich drinks.

Listen to your body's signals and adjust your fluid intake accordingly. Symptoms of dehydration include headache, so it's important to stay proactive.

By prioritizing hydration, you can maximize your keto journey and support overall health and well-being.

Beyond Water: Exploring Keto-Friendly Hydration Options

Water is essential for hydration, but on a ketogenic diet, there are other appealing options to keep you vigorous. Electrolyte levels is crucial when limiting carbohydrates, and certain beverages can help.

Consider unsweetened herbal beverages like green tea or peppermint tea, which are caloric. Sparkling water with a squeeze of citrus adds a zesty twist. Coconut water is naturally rich in electrolytes and can be a tasty alternative to sugary drinks. Remember to reduce your intake of sweetened beverages, as they can harmfully impact your keto progress.
